🎨 How to color it

Layer cool slate blue on the mountain shadows, deep pine green on the snow-tipped evergreens, warm ocher on the two tents, and ember orange in the small campfire. Use sharp colored pencils for the engraved hatching on the peaks, tree needles, smoke column, and curved snowdrifts, following each line direction instead of covering it flat. Let the footprints glow with a faint lavender-blue shadow so the trail feels quietly pressed into fresh morning snow.
